Danny The Dragon Author Nominated For Prestigious Book Award

Children's author, researcher, and humanitarian Tina Turbin (http://TinaTurbin.com) has been honored as a Finalist in the prestigious National Best Books 2009 Awards for her celebrated children's book, Danny the Dragon Meets Jimmy (http://DannyTheDragon.com), in the Best Children's Picture Book category. The winners and finalists of the book contest, sponsored by USA Book News, were announced recently on USABookNews.com, the preeminent online magazine and review website for both mainstream and independent publishing houses.
"This is quite an honor," Turbin says regarding the nomination. "[Illustrator] Aija Jasuna has certainly done an amazing job and this was quite a beautiful collaboration."
Turbin has been busy this year promoting her book and working on related projects. She recently announced the debut of the Danny the Dragon DREAMS CD on October 30 at a very special Halloween family concert at Pasadena City College in Pasadena, California. The CD (proceeds will go to the Celiac Disease Research Center at the Columbia University Medical Center) will contain a reading of the book by a talented vocal artist, ...
... followed by a compilation of ten original classic songs by up-and-coming composers.

A literacy advocate, Turbin, alarmed by the literacy statistic among the deaf, has recently begun raising support for education for deaf children. Turbin will feature at the concert part of her soon-to-be-released Danny the Dragon DVD, a signed reading of the book for deaf children. Half the proceeds of this project will be donated to the local deaf children's school, Blossom's Montessori School for the Deaf in Clearwater, Florida as well as other Causes she supports.
Turbin's book was the 2nd place winner for the 2009 Arizona Literary Contest and Book Awards, announced at a grand banquet on November 7 in Glendale, Arizona. Tina was unable to attend yet was extremely honored to receive this award in the category of Children's Literature.
